Pune to Tarkarli Family Road Trip: 3-Day Coastal Escape (via Kolhapur & Sindhudurg)

Viewed by 176 travelers

Day 1: Drive & Arrival

Pune, India to Tarkarli, India on October 24, 2025

6:00am

Depart Pune

Leave early to avoid city traffic and make the long drive comfortable for the family; total drive time is ~8–9 hours including stops (approx 430–470 km via NH48/NH66).
INR0, 0h30m

8:30am

Breakfast stop (Satara/Karad highway dhaba)

Stop at a clean highway dhaba near Satara/Karad for quick, hearty Marathi breakfast items (poha, misal, fresh chai) to energize the drive; most highway dhabas open by 7:00–8:00.
INR250, 0h45m

12:30pm

Lunch in Kolhapur (Kolhapuri Thali)

Break the drive in Kolhapur and enjoy a spicy Kolhapuri thali — a good family-friendly option is a well-reviewed local thali restaurant (opens ~11:00–15:00), which also gives kids a chance to stretch their legs.
INR350, 1h

2:00pm

Short Kolhapur stop (optional) — Mahalaxmi Darshan or Rankala Lake stroll

If time and energy permit, visit the Mahalaxmi Temple (open typically 6:00–12:30 & 16:00–20:00) for a quick darshan or take a 20–30 minute walk at Rankala Lake to relax before continuing south.
INR0, 0h45m

3:00pm

Drive Kolhapur to Tarkarli

Continue through coastal Maharashtra roads toward Malvan/Tarkarli; scenic ghats and coastal plains appear as you approach the Konkan region—expect 3.5–4 hours driving.
INR0, 3h30m

6:30pm

Check-in at Tarkarli accommodation

Arrive at your hotel/resort in Tarkarli, check in and freshen up. Choose family-friendly beachfront properties for easy access to the sand and evening strolls.
INR0, 0h30m

7:30pm

Dinner — Malvani seafood or family restaurant

Try fresh Malvani seafood at a recommended local restaurant or request a milder preparation for kids; many places open for dinner 19:00–22:00. Non-seafood options are available too.
INR600, 1h15m

9:00pm

Evening beach walk & rest

Short walk on Tarkarli beach to enjoy the sea breeze and plan water activities for tomorrow before an early night after the long drive.
INR0, 0h30m

Day 2: Water Activities

Tarkarli / Devbag / Sindhudurg, India on October 25, 2025

7:30am

Breakfast at hotel

Have an early breakfast at the hotel to prepare for water activities; many hotels serve from 7:00–9:00. A hearty breakfast keeps kids and adults energized for morning boat trips.
INR300, 0h30m

8:30am

Boat out to Tarkarli reef / Snorkeling or Scuba

Book a morning snorkeling (good for families) or introductory scuba dive (min age depends on operator, usually 10+ for snorkeling, 12+ for scuba) trip to the clear waters off Tarkarli or Devbag—operators run trips roughly 8:00–16:00 and mornings are calmer and clearer.
INR1200, 3h0m

12:00pm

Lunch in Malvan or Tarkarli (Malvani cuisine)

Enjoy a relaxed lunch at a recommended Malvani restaurant near the beach; request less-spicy options for children and choose from fish thali, rice, and vegetable sides (restaurants generally open 12:00–15:00).
INR400, 1h0m

2:00pm

Relax on Tarkarli Beach / Jet-ski / Banana boat

Spend a relaxed afternoon on the wide Tarkarli beach; for more excitement, choose family-friendly water sports like jet-skiing or banana boat rides (operators typically 9:00–17:00).
INR800, 1h30m

4:00pm

Sindhudurg Fort visit (by boat and walk)

Take a short boat ride to Sindhudurg Fort (boats/visit hours usually 9:00–17:00); explore the historic island fort built by Shivaji — a great cultural stop with good photo opportunities.
INR150, 1h30m

6:00pm

Sunset at Devbag Creek

Drive or boat to Devbag Creek for a calm sunset view where the Karli River meets the Arabian Sea — ideal for family photos and a quieter beach scene.
INR0, 0h45m

8:00pm

Dinner in Tarkarli (family-friendly seafood or vegetarian)

Choose a nearby restaurant or your resort’s dining to try Malvani specialties or milder dishes for kids; many places stay open till 21:30–22:00.
INR600, 1h0m

Day 3: Morning Cruise & Return

Tarkarli to Pune, India on October 26, 2025

6:30am

Morning backwater boat cruise (Karli River / Chivla)

Take a calm early-morning backwater boat ride through the Karli River mangroves—great for birdwatching and a peaceful family experience. Operators often run 6:00–9:00 for cooler, quieter conditions.
INR1500, 1h0m

8:00am

Breakfast and check-out

Return to the hotel for breakfast, pack, and check out. Aim to leave Tarkarli by about 9:30–10:00 to make the drive back to Pune comfortable with stops.
INR300, 1h0m

10:00am

Drive from Tarkarli toward Kolhapur (return leg)

Begin the northbound drive; expect ~3.5–4 hours to Kolhapur where you can stop for lunch and a short visit if missed on Day 1.
INR0, 3h30m

1:30pm

Lunch in Kolhapur (if not done earlier) - local favourites

Enjoy a relaxed lunch in Kolhapur — try local non-spicy options for kids or a family restaurant with varied choices (most open 12:00–15:00).
INR350, 1h0m

2:30pm

Optional Mahalaxmi Temple visit (Kolhapur)

If you didn’t visit earlier, stop by Mahalaxmi Temple (open typically 6:00–12:30 & 16:00–20:00) for a brief darshan; otherwise stretch legs at Rankala Lake.
INR0, 0h45m

3:30pm

Drive Kolhapur to Pune

Final leg of the drive back to Pune; expect 4–4.5 hours depending on traffic, with a tea/toilet stop en route.
INR0, 4h30m

8:30pm

Arrive Pune & trip end

Reach Pune in the evening, unpack, and rest. Consider sharing photos and notes of the trip while unwinding at home.
INR0, 0h30m
